In this episode of the French Rugby CONNECTIONS Podcast, Veronique Landew and co-host Bill Hooper react to France’s shock loss to Scotland at Murrayfield—ending Grand Slam hopes—while crediting Scotland’s intensity, France’s poor defense and discipline, and small disruptions in preparation. They note France’s late rally to secure a try bonus point that could still prove decisive, and turn to “Le Crunch” in Paris versus England, with France still able to win the Six Nations. The discussion covers squad changes, including Anthony Jelonch's injury, Oscar Jegou's suspension, and debutante, Temo Matiu from Union Bordeaux Begles, plus concerns about strip colors. They also review England’s historic loss to Italy, Italy’s progress, French club bankruptcies, and the death of 1968 Grand Slam captain Claude Lacaze.
